Accommodation for International Students

Choosing suitable accommodation is such an important part of your study experience at Gower College Swansea. We are pleased to offer two excellent options for our international students: Homestay or Student Residence. Each option provides a safe, comfortable, and supportive environment, catering to different preferences and needs. 

Homestay

Our homestay hosts give students the opportunity to live with a local family. This option allows students to gain an authentic insight into British life and to improve their English. 

Students have their own private bedroom with storage, study space and WiFi plus a key to the house. Breakfast and evening meals are also provided each day.  

Our homestay families are carefully selected, vetted and monitored by our International Team; following our high standards of safeguarding, all family members over 18 have successfully completed a Disclosure and Barring Services (DBS) check. 

The host family could be a couple or an individual, some have children and some have pets. Each host has a profile which includes details of their profession, family members, interests and house location. 

Many of our hosts are very experienced and have enjoyed sharing their homes with students from all over the world, often keeping in touch with one another for many years. 

After your College Induction, you and your host family will go through a Homestay Agreement Form, stating the roles and responsibilities of the family, yourself and the College which will be signed by all parties. The agreement is important and helpful for everyone as you settle into to your new home environment.

Student residence

Nicholaston House


Our student residence, Nicholaston House, provides a tranquil living experience while offering full supervision and support from onsite staff. Situated in the stunning surroundings of the Gower Peninsula in Swansea, it offers a peaceful and inspiring environment for students.

Students benefit from 24-hour care provided by our dedicated Residential Team, in a warm and nurturing setting that promotes inclusivity, personal growth, and a sense of community. The environment is designed to help young people build independence and confidence while enjoying a positive and supportive boarding experience. 

There is a weekday bus service providing direct and reliable transport between Nicholaston House and Gower College Swansea campus. On weekends, students have access to special transport services to the city centre and local supermarkets for added convenience.
